About В. А. Петров

В. А. Петров is a scholar working on Geology, Geophysics and Fuel Technology, having authored 49 papers that have together received 278 indexed citations. Recurring topics across this work include Geochemistry and Geologic Mapping (18 papers), Geological and Geochemical Analysis (17 papers) and Radioactive element chemistry and processing (15 papers). The work is most often cited by research in Inorganic Chemistry (112 citations), Ceramics and Composites (42 citations) and Geophysics (67 citations). В. А. Петров has collaborated with scholars based in Russia, United Kingdom and Germany. Frequent co-authors include S. V. Yudintsev, Michael I. Ojovan, V. I. Malkovsky, О. В. Андреева, Д. В. Коваленко, Yu. L. Rebetsky, Yu. P. Dikov, Ya. V. Bychkova, Peisen Miao and Vladimir G. Petrov. Their work appears in journals such as SHILAP Revista de lepidopterología, Geochimica et Cosmochimica Acta and Sustainability.
